Atlanta United FC Competes Against Pumas UNAM in 2025 Leagues Cup

WHAT'S THE STORY?

What's Happening?

Atlanta United FC faced off against Pumas UNAM in the second match of the 2025 Leagues Cup. The game took place in Orlando, marking a significant event for both teams as they vie for advancement in the tournament. Atlanta United, known for its competitive edge in Major League Soccer, aimed to leverage its strengths against the Mexican team, Pumas UNAM. The match is part of a series of games that bring together clubs from different leagues, fostering international competition and showcasing diverse football talents.
